A Friendly Voice. A Call to Volunteer by Phone. Become a Bereavement Telephone Volunteer

Save to Favorites

ORGANIZATION: VITAS Healthcare of Dade

  • 95 people are interested

If you enjoy talking on the phone and have time to make a few calls, you may be a perfect Bereavement Telephone Assurance (BTAP) Volunteer.

Vitas BTAP Volunteers make phone calls to bereaved family members after a hospice patient’s death.

These phone calls go a long way to make a difference in the lives of those coping with grief. Use your compassion, listening skills and time to give back to your community and strengthen your resume. We will provide no-cost training and coaching. Hours are flexible and calls can be made from home, dorm room or apartment.

Mission Statement

VITAS Healthcare recognizes the importance of a strong and innovative program. Volunteers are an integral part of the hospice program, allowing VITAS to continue personalizing, enhancing and expanding services offered to patients and families. By exemplifying the VITAS Values, volunteers serve as patient and family advocates and are proactive in meeting the needs of patients and families. VITAS integrates volunteers into the hospice team by actively recruiting, training, supporting and creatively utilizing volunteers to meet patient and family needs. Volunteers and their contributions are respected and valued.

Description

Volunteers are the heart of VITAS Healthcare(r), providing friendly, non-medical support to hospice patients and their family or offering support services in the office. We are seeking caring and compassionate individuals to volunteer for our patients in their homes or in nursing facilities in your community throughout Dade County.
